Latest Patents
One of Huff's latest patents is a vacuum assembly for automobiles. This system is designed to fit into a cavity within the vehicle, featuring a tank that can be removed laterally without the need for tools or detaching the vacuum hose. The design includes a circuit board that carries an electronic controller, positioned alongside the motor, which helps in efficient operation. Cooling air is drawn through an inlet on the cabin wall, ensuring that the motor remains cool during use.
Another notable patent is the vacuum assembly with an inlet through a removable tank. This assembly can be mounted in a vehicle, with the motor and fan positioned above a chassis wall. The tank is designed to slide horizontally from a forward position to an elevated rearward position, allowing for easy access and maintenance. The innovative design ensures that the inlet and outlet are disconnected when the tank is removed, enhancing user convenience.
